I'd never seen The Cult before, and I came in knowing they were a couple decades past their prime. I heard the original singer and guitarist would be the core of the band, they had three other musicians filling things out for them. The guitarist still rocks it - he's really good. The hired guns hold their own as well, particularly the drummer, who has an enviable job anyway. The weakest link was the singing; I think it was mixed low intentionally, since the singer just can't pull the load anymore. Some of the great, drawn-out wailing from the albums just doesn't happen - think of 'Rain' without the ' . . . and let it come down!' really getting nailed, or the chanted 'Revolution' at the end without the punch. Still, with that said, the sets are good, the juicy guitars keep things bouncing, and you can always try singing youself to cover those gaps. Good show.

The Cult played the entire classic "Love" album and more hits to a mostly dead crowd at the House Of Blues in Cleveland on 11/9/09.
The sound was great, as guitarist Billy Duffy sounding as he does on the albums. The rest of the group, John Tempesta on drums, Chris Wyse on bass and Mike Dimkich on rhythm guitar backed up Billy perfectly.
The only problem is singer Ian Astbury, sings the lyrics as he sees fit, making it hard to sing along. Ian was channeling Jim Morrison with his full beard, and limited range of motion due to recent hip surgery. But his voice was as good as ever. I was suprised he didn't chastise the crowd more for their lack of enthusiasm.
It was sad to see a crowd so listless as rock legends played on tour for maybe the last time in their career.

Ian, Billy and the boys came to Cleveland to rock the House and that's exactly what they did. The unmistakable guitar sound on Love was provided by Billy's Gretch White Falcon, from which he ripped the riffs with expert precision and passion.
Ian's voice was strong and clear, and he was more communicative with the audience than I had seen at previous Cult shows. Sporting the Jim Morrison beard and mustache, he cranked on the tambourine while the very capable rythm section laid down the familiar beats.
After delivering the goods and plowing through the revered Love album, they took a very short break and returned to bang some heads with favorites from Electric and Sonic Temple. That's when the guitar work of William Henry Duffy was prominently featured as his grinding, crunchy licks assaulted the senses of all in attendence. If you are a fan, don't miss this opportunity to catch them in an intimate venue like HOB.
Excellent show.
